Introduction

Pursuant to Florida Administrative Code, certain facilities are required to submit a Comprehensive Emergency Management Plan (CEMP) to their local Emergency Management office for annual review. These facilities include:

Adult Day Care Facilities

Ambulatory Surgical Centers

Assisted Living Facilities

Group Homes

Hospitals

Nursing Homes

Residential Treatment Facilities

The Agency for Health Care Administration (AHCA) and Agency for Persons with Disabilities(APD) both develop and publish the minimum criteria for the CEMP. To make the approval process more efficient, facilities should submit the ACHA or APD Planning Criteria paperwork with their CEMP (see links above). Please use the document as a cross-reference to the plan by listing the page number and paragraph where the criteria can be found. This will ensure accurate review of the plan.
